The Agreement: A totally gripping psychological thriller full of twists Jacqueline Ward
A twisting new thriller from the author of The Replacement: Is the man she married in troubleor is he just trouble?
Kate and Jake agreed when they got married that they would always give each other space. But lately, Jake seems to want a lot more space than Kates comfortable with. Hes growing more distant with every day. In an angry attempt to figure out why, she doesnt take the turn for their road on the way home from work. She keeps on driving and takes a room at a local hotel to conduct a bit of spyingand discovers some worrisome information.
But when she returns home to confront him, Jake isnt just emotionally distanthes gone, along with all his things. All that remains is a lone laptop with a map of everywhere she has been over the past days and a timer that is ticking down.
Kate turns to the police, who just think shes been dumped. Then comes an anonymous threat and a demand for money. Nothing seems to make sense. Will she ever get her husband back? And does she really want to?
